Description

A kind of Head end of cable pulley
Technical field
The present invention relates to logistics equipment technical field, more specifically to a kind of Head end of cable pulley.
Background technology
Number of patent application be CN 201310558776.0, the applying date be 2013.11.12 Chinese invention patent disclose A kind of elastic buffer for cable trailing, including the cylinder body with plunger shaft, the piston rod in the plunger shaft, The plunger shaft is divided into rod chamber and rodless cavity by the piston rod, and the piston rod includes guide ring and solid with the guide ring Surely the sliding bar connected, filled with hydraulic oil in the rodless cavity, is provided with extension spring in the rod chamber, the guide ring is provided with the It is provided with one intercommunicating pore and the second intercommunicating pore, first intercommunicating pore and prevents the hydraulic oil in the rodless cavity from having described in Second check valve is installed, when the pressure of hydraulic oil in the rodless cavity in the first check valve in rod cavity, second intercommunicating pore So that the hydraulic oil enters the rod chamber when reaching the second unidirectional valve opening pressure.
But, the elastic buffer of the Head end of cable pulley is complicated, and fault rate is higher in real work.
The content of the invention
It is an object of the invention to provide a kind of Head end of cable pulley is used, it can overcome in place of the deficiencies in the prior art, it is tied Structure is novel, and easy to make, with low cost, fault rate is low, good buffer effect.
The present invention is achieved by the following technical solutions, a kind of Head end of cable pulley, including supporting plate and the supporting plate The support that is connected, fixed two pairs of side plates on the bracket, installed in a pair of taper disk rollers described in every a pair on side plate And a pair of buffer units for being directed laterally to wheel, being located at described support one end, the axis for being directed laterally to wheel and the taper Disk roller axis perpendicular, the support other end is provided with end extension board, and the end extension board is provided with connecting hole;It is described slow Flushing device include installing plate, be located on the installing plate mounting seat, be located in the mounting seat the first sliding cavity, be located at institute State the first sliding bar in the first sliding cavity, the first buffer gear for entering row buffering to first sliding bar and described The second sliding cavity that first sliding cavity is communicated and the second buffer gear being located in second sliding cavity.
Preferably, second buffer gear includes slip crash panel, the fixation point being located in second sliding cavity Cut multiple mounting holes that plate is located on the fixed fragmenting plate and the sliding plunger being located on the mounting hole, the fixation point Cut and the closed chamber full of grease is formed between plate and the second sliding cavity bottom surface.
Preferably, provided with cunning in the radial cavity that the mounting seat is provided with and the closed chamber is communicated, the radial cavity Motion block, the disc spring for adjusting plug screw and being located between sliding shoe, regulation plug screw.
Preferably, the quantity of the disc spring is 5-8.
Preferably, described first slides boom end provided with block rubber.
Preferably, first buffer gear includes compression spring.
In summary, the invention has the advantages that:
Simple in construction, easy to make, with low cost, operating efficiency is high, and fault rate is low, good buffer effect.

Embodiment
The present invention is described in further detail below in conjunction with accompanying drawing.
This specific embodiment is only explanation of the invention, and it is not limitation of the present invention, people in the art Member can make the modification without creative contribution to the present embodiment as needed after this specification is read, but as long as at this All protected in the right of invention by Patent Law.
Embodiment:As shown in Figure 1, 2, 3, a kind of Head end of cable pulley, including the branch that supporting plate 9 is connected with the supporting plate 9 Frame 10, two pairs of side plates 11 being fixed on the support 10, installed in a pair of taper disk rollers 12 described in every a pair on side plate 11 And a pair of buffer units for being directed laterally to wheel 13, being located at described one end of support 10, supporting plate quantity is 2, is directed laterally to wheel 13 It is vertically arranged with taper disk roller 12;The axis and the axis perpendicular of taper disk roller 12 for being directed laterally to wheel 13, the branch The other end of frame 10 is provided with end extension board 1001, and the end extension board 1001 is provided with connecting hole 1002, connecting hole 1002 Provided with retaining mechanism 8;The buffer unit includes installing plate 1, the mounting seat 2 being located on the installing plate 1, is located at the installation Seat 2 on the first sliding cavity 3, be located in first sliding cavity 3 the first sliding bar 4, for entering to first sliding bar 4 The second sliding cavity 7 and be located at second slip that the first buffer gear 5 and first sliding cavity 3 of row buffering are communicated The second buffer gear 6 in chamber 7.
Installing plate 1 is provided with installation screw, and installing plate is rigid plate, and thickness is 8-10mm;Mounting seat 2 is rigid holder, by Forging is made, and installs plate weld or be spirally connected;What the gap of the first sliding bar 4 coordinated is located in the first sliding cavity 3, is slided first The end of bar 4 is provided with block rubber 9;The thickness of block rubber 9 is 25-30mm.Second buffer gear 6 includes compression spring, compresses bullet Spring is sleeved on the first sliding bar 4;When by external force, compression spring, which is pressurized, is shunk, and the first sliding bar 4 is slided first Slided in dynamic chamber 3 to the direction of the second buffer gear 6, reach precalculated position and the second buffer gear 6 is contacted, by the second buffer gear 6 enter row buffering.
Second buffer gear 6 includes slip crash panel 601, the fixed fragmenting plate being located in second sliding cavity 7 The 602 multiple mounting holes 603 being located on the fixed fragmenting plate 602 and the sliding plunger being located on the mounting hole 603 604, the closed chamber 605 full of grease is formed between the fixed fragmenting plate 602 and the bottom surface of the second sliding cavity 6, grease is adopted Use butter;After sliding impact of the crash panel 601 by the first sliding bar 4, by pressure dissipation to multiple sliding plungers 604, Acted on again by sliding plunger 604 on the grease in closed chamber 605, mounting seat is provided with oil addition mouthful, oil addition mouthful It is provided with plug screw.
Further, the radial cavity 606 that the mounting seat 2 is provided with and the closed chamber 605 is communicated, the radial cavity Provided with sliding shoe 607, regulation plug screw 608 and the disc spring 609 being located between sliding shoe 607, regulation plug screw 608 in 606, work as oil When the pressure that fat is subject to is excessive, the pressure overcomes the elastic force of disc spring so that sliding shoe 607 enters line slip, amount of grease Into radial cavity 606;The quantity of the disc spring 609 is 5-8.
Connecting rope that the retaining mechanism 8 can be pointed in connecting hole etc. is locked, and prevents it from loosening or shaking It is dynamic, it is ensured that the stability of connection, slip gripping block 801 that retaining mechanism 8 includes being located in the connecting hole, it is located at the slip Gripping block inclined plane 802 in gripping block 801, the adjusting screw 803 being screwed onto on the extension board 201 and the adjustment spiral shell The adjustment block 804 of the connection of nail 803 and the adjustment being located in the adjustment block 804 with the gripping block inclined plane 802 laminating are inclined Inclined-plane 805;Extension board is provided with the mounting groove for mounting and adjusting block, and mounting groove and connecting hole are communicated, and mounting groove is vertically arranged; The adjustment block 804 is provided with ring cavity 806, and the connection ring 807 being fixedly connected with the adjusting screw 803 is located at the ring cavity 806 It is interior.Slided for the ease of sliding gripping block in connecting hole, slide the upper/lower terminal of gripping block provided with extension sliding block, connecting hole It is provided with and extends the extension chute of sliding block cooperation;The adjustment inclined plane 805 is located at the vertical plane of the adjustment block 804 On, and the vertical plane and the adjustment inclined plane 805 are into 12-13 ° of angle.The gripping block inclined plane 802 is located at described On the perpendicular for sliding gripping block 801, and the perpendicular and the gripping block inclined plane 802 are into 12-13 ° of angle.
